"outfake" meaning in English

See outfake in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Verb

Forms: outfakes [present, singular, third-person], outfaking [participle, present], outfaked [participle, past], outfaked [past]
Etymology: From out- + fake. Etymology templates: {{prefix|en|out|fake}} out- + fake Head templates: {{en-verb}} outfake (third-person singular simple present outfakes, present participle outfaking, simple past and past participle outfaked)
  1. (transitive) To fake or fake out more or better than (another) Tags: transitive
